In just over two years, the Interior Department has quickly checked items off of the oil and gas industry’s wish list, offering leases to more than 18 million acres of public lands for oil and gas development, proposing to open the Arctic National Wildlife Refuge and virtually the entire American coastline for drilling, and rolling back a raft of drilling safeguards. Now, the Trump administration has shifted its focus to the mining industry’s list of requests, announcing a plan to dramatically ramp up mining in the United States. The move puts some of the West’s most iconic public lands, including the Grand Canyon and Bears Ears National Monument, in jeopardy.
